Who are chickens related to?
Chickens are related to a wide range of animals, but they are most closely related to other birds. They belong to the order Galliformes, which also includes:
* Turkeys
* Pheasants
* Quails
* Grouse
Within the Galliformes order, chickens are specifically classified in the family Phasianidae.
